Clancy Redbeard, the ne'er-do-well son of a Virginia pirate, resists Benjamin Franklin and George Washington's pleas to join their fight against the British, but gets swept up in the American Revolution when he becomes the consort of an abolitionist pirate, Captain Death. Fans of Patrick O'Brian's "Aubrey-Maturin" series, Jane Austen, George MacDonald Fraser's "Flashman," and the humor of Douglas Adams will enjoy this unconventional tale of two pirates battling George the Third, mid-life crises, and each other, told with Jurgen Vsych's inimitable wit and beautifully designed with 60 rare illustrations from the vaults of the world's finest art and maritime museums."
